USS Discovery, Xenobotany Labs – 1130

Lt. J.G. Natalie Keely nervously set the corbaris seculiran plant in the appropriately sterilized and fetilized pot, then set the containment field to the exact temperature specified to keep the delicate plant alive. This was her fourth try at re-potting the offspring of the much larger and even more demanding parent plant and the first three had wilted immediately as soon as she put up the field. So, for this last one she was extremely careful and also very worried it would also die...field set...and it appeared unaffected. Natalie sighed. She watched for a moment to ensure all was ok with the sprout, but it was not showing any signs of wilting at all. She pushed a blond curl from her face and tucked it behind her ear. "Wonderful!" she said to herself and the scientific log the computer was recording as she stated each step in the process aloud for her own records. "Operation four was a success." she stated, her brilliant green eyes shining in the specialized lighting. "Computer: End recording."

Smiling, she walked away, happy that at least one of the difficult plant's offspring was surviving so far. She scooped up the others to place in bio-reclamation units and then washed her work station and her hands. Everything was all set for the morning and she could leave the lab for a small break, so she headed for the ship's lounge to have a cup of tea. She had some protien extractions to do on a Romulan Jaffa root later and wanted to be re-charged before the next big job.
